Hello,
I am interested in running strategies from the strategies tab in the control box. But to do that I need to specify a start date for the strategy to be sure that there are enough bars. I am running NT 6.5.1000.5 and I cannot find the from date as an input parameter in the time frame section of the 'New strategy' window that I open from the 'control centre'. I checked the NT documentation online and the screen snapshot in the 'Running NT script from strategies tab' section contains the from date in the time frame section. has there been a change in NT since the documentation was produced? If not how can I define a start date for the strategy? What is the default period that NT assumes if no start date is defined? Thanks for your help. regards, |

The default days back is based on the settings under Tools > Options > Data, check the "Chart default look back period (days)" section.
